Kering Finance Senior Tax Specialist
SummaryAbout usKering is a global Luxury group that manages the development of a collection of renowned Houses in Fashion, Leather Goods and Jewelry: Gucci, Saint Laurent, Bottega Veneta, Balenciaga, Alexander McQueen, Brioni, Boucheron, Pomellato, Dodo, Qeelin, Ginori 1735, as well as Kering Eyewear and Kering Beauté.
By placing creativity at the heart of its strategy, Kering enables its Houses to set new limits in terms of their creative expression while crafting tomorrow's Luxury in a sustainable and responsible way.
We capture these beliefs in our signature: Empowering Imagination.
In 2023, Kering had 49, 000 employees and revenue of 19. 6 billion. The Corporate Tax team of Kering Group is currently seeking an Italian and English speaker Gucci Senior Tax Specialist to join our dynamic team based in Milan. Job DescriptionYour opportunityYou will be supporting the Gucci Head of Tax on multiple operations of the tax practice area. How you will contributeDeal with Tax aspects involving the Group from a domestic and international point of view, including VAT and custom dutiesReview tax benefits (i. e.
Patent Box, R&D credit) and tax reimbursementsSupport the Group companies in relation to tax audits, tax assessments and related mattersDeliver a full range of tax services in compliance with laws and regulations within timeframeParticipate in the review of tax returns and related complianceActively participate in the management of the budgeting and reporting processes for the Group companiesSupport with the identification, development and implementation of tax opportunities in the direct or indirect tax areaSupport the tax manager and HQ in the preparation of the Transfer Pricing country file and determination of Intercompany pricing and adjustmentWho you areA Law graduate or Accounting.
Master in tax law is a plusA tax law expert with a senior demonstrated experienceProficient in Tax software/database, Excel and WordA professional with strong analytical, ownership and accountability skillsAn individual able to analyse legal and tax topics with a precise an accurate approachAn excellent communicator at every level in the organization with excellent interpersonal skillsFluent in Italian and English, both written and spokenWhy work with us?
